Small Heath Station offers essential services to facilitate your journey.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 07:00 to 10:00, ensuring you can grab a last-minute ticket or seek help if needed.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, and you can collect tickets purchased online here too. It's worth noting that while the station is fitted with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, it lacks step-free access—a crucial point for travelers with mobility needs.
Even though Small Heath Station doesn't have a waiting room, there are seating areas to ensure comfort while you wait. Additionally, CCTV coverage throughout the station helps in ensuring passenger security. While there are no refreshment facilities or shops here, the vibrancy of Birmingham ensures you'll find plenty of those in the vicinity.
Small Heath's connectivity spans beyond trains, with various travel options available. Rail replacement services, when required, operate from the front of the station, making it easy for passengers to switch travel modes without a hitch. Taxis are readily available with local services like Heartlands and Silverline offering convenient pick-up and drop-off options. For the eco-conscious or budget traveler, local bus services provide an excellent way to navigate Birmingham's sights and sounds.

At Pevensey & Westham station, ticket-buying is simple and convenient. Although the ticket office operates during weekday mornings from 6:30 to 10:40, there are ticket machines readily available for use at any time, including provisions for collecting online reservations. Accessibility is well-considered with machines designed for ease of use for passengers with disabilities, and smartcard facilities are in place for those using Southern services.
For travelers requiring extra assistance, there are several help points throughout the station. Monday to Friday, staff are available for a few hours in the morning to help guide and support all passengers. Step-free access is partially available, ensuring ease for those using wheelchairs or pushing prams. Additional assistance with a ramp is accessible upon request.
While the station doesn't offer taxi services, the bus connectivity helps fill this gap. Local buses can easily take you to nearby attractions and are your gateway to exploring Pevensey, a town rich in history and beautiful landscapes. Onward travel maps are available to help plan your journey, and in case of rail disruptions, a rail replacement service is provided.
